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Interaction Calls |  FileMan Files Accessed Via FileMan Db Call |  Global Variables Directly Accessed |  Local Variables  | All
Print Page as PDF
Routine: YTPXRM

Package: Mental Health

Routine: YTPXRM


Information

YTPXRM ; SLC/PKR - Build indexes for Mental Health. ;10/28/2003

Source Information

Source file <YTPXRM.m>

Call Graph

Call Graph

Call Graph Total: 4

Package Total Call Graph
Kernel 2 $$NOW^XLFDT  (BMES,MES)^XPDUTL  
Clinical Reminders 1 (COMMSG,DETIME,ERRMSG)^PXRMSXRM  
VA FileMan 1 $$GET1^DID  

Caller Graph

Legends:

Legend of Colors

Package Component Superscript legend

action A extended action Ea event driver Ed subscriber Su protocol O limited protocol LP run routine RR broker B edit E server Se print P screenman SM inquire I

Caller Graph

Caller Graph Total: 3

Package Total Caller Graph
Mental Health 3 YSXRAC3  YSXRAC7  ^YTD(601.2  

Entry Points

Name Comments DBIA/ICR reference
INDEX ;Build the index for MENTAL HEALTH.
  • ICR #4523
    • Status: Active
    • Usage: Private
    KMH(X,DA) ;Delete index for Psych Instrument Patient File
    SMH(X,DA) ;Set index for Psych Instrument Patient File

    External References

    Name Field # of Occurrence
    $$GET1^DID INDEX+5
    COMMSG^PXRMSXRM INDEX+37
    DETIME^PXRMSXRM INDEX+33
    ERRMSG^PXRMSXRM INDEX+35
    $$NOW^XLFDT INDEX+40
    BMES^XPDUTL INDEX+10
    MES^XPDUTL INDEX+12, INDEX+19, INDEX+32

    Interaction Calls

    Name Line Occurrences
    Function Call: WRITE
    • Prompt: "."
    • Line Location: INDEX+20

    FileMan Files Accessed Via FileMan Db Call

    FileNo Call Tags
    ^YTD(601.2 - [#601.2] GET1^DID

    Global Variables Directly Accessed

    Name Line Occurrences  (* Changed,  ! Killed)
    ^PXRMINDX(601.2 INDEX+4!, INDEX+27*, INDEX+28*, INDEX+38*, INDEX+39*, INDEX+40*, KMH+3!, KMH+4!, SMH+5*, SMH+6*
    ^YTD(601.2 - [#601.2] INDEX+6, INDEX+15, INDEX+22, INDEX+25

    Local Variables

    Legend:

    >> Not killed explicitly
    * Changed
    ! Killed
    ~ Newed

    Name Field # of Occurrence
    DA KMH~, SMH~
    DA(1 KMH+2, KMH+3, KMH+4, SMH+4, SMH+5, SMH+6
    DA(2 KMH+2, KMH+3, KMH+4, SMH+4, SMH+5, SMH+6
    DAS INDEX+1~, INDEX+26*, INDEX+27, INDEX+28, KMH+1~, KMH+2*, KMH+3, KMH+4, SMH+3~, SMH+4*
    , SMH+5, SMH+6
    DAST INDEX+1~, INDEX+23*, INDEX+26
    DATE INDEX+1~, INDEX+24*, INDEX+25*, INDEX+26, INDEX+27, INDEX+28
    DFN INDEX+1~, INDEX+14*, INDEX+15*, INDEX+22, INDEX+23, INDEX+25, INDEX+27, INDEX+28
    DUZ INDEX+39
    END INDEX+1~, INDEX+30*, INDEX+33, INDEX+37
    ENTRIES INDEX+1~, INDEX+6*, INDEX+7, INDEX+11
    GLOBAL INDEX+1~, INDEX+5*, INDEX+35, INDEX+37, INDEX+38
    IND INDEX+1~, INDEX+14*, INDEX+16*, INDEX+17, INDEX+18, INDEX+20
    INS INDEX+1~, INDEX+21*, INDEX+22*, INDEX+23, INDEX+25, INDEX+27, INDEX+28
    NE INDEX+1~, INDEX+14*, INDEX+29*, INDEX+31, INDEX+37
    NERROR INDEX+1~, INDEX+14*, INDEX+35, INDEX+37
    START INDEX+2~, INDEX+13*, INDEX+33, INDEX+37
    TENP INDEX+2~, INDEX+7*, INDEX+8*, INDEX+9*, INDEX+17
    TEXT INDEX+2~, INDEX+11*, INDEX+12, INDEX+18*, INDEX+19, INDEX+31*, INDEX+32
    U INDEX+6
    X KMH~, SMH~
    X(1 KMH+2, KMH+3, KMH+4, SMH+4, SMH+5, SMH+6
    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Interaction Calls |  FileMan Files Accessed Via FileMan Db Call |  Global Variables Directly Accessed |  Local Variables  | All